Medical Plastic Compound Market in Thailand Trends and Forecast
The future of the medical plastic compound market in Thailand looks promising with opportunities in the disposable, catheter, surgical instrument, medical bag, implant, and drug delivery system markets. The global medical plastic compound market is expected to grow with a CAGR of 7.1% from 2025 to 2031. The medical plastic compound market in Thailand is also forecasted to witness strong growth over the forecast period. The major drivers for this market are the increasing demand for medical devices, the rising need for patient safety, and the growing focus on healthcare advancements.
• Lucintel forecasts that, within the product category, polycarbonate is expected to witness the highest growth over the forecast period due to the rising biocompatibility for medical applications.
• Within the application category, the drug delivery system is expected to witness the highest growth due to the increasing demand for targeted therapies.
Emerging Trends in the Medical Plastic Compound Market in Thailand
The medical plastic compound market in Thailand is experiencing rapid growth driven by technological advancements, increasing healthcare demands, and a shift towards sustainable materials. As Thailand positions itself as a regional hub for medical manufacturing, innovative compounds are becoming essential for medical devices, packaging, and sterilization processes. These developments are transforming the industry landscape, creating new opportunities and challenges for manufacturers and stakeholders alike. Understanding these emerging trends is crucial for strategic planning and competitive advantage in this dynamic market.
• Rising demand for biocompatible plastics: The increasing need for safe, non-toxic materials in medical applications is driving the development of biocompatible plastics. These compounds reduce adverse reactions and improve patient safety, making them essential for implants, syringes, and other devices. This trend enhances product reliability and fosters innovation in medical plastics.
• Adoption of sustainable and eco-friendly materials: Environmental concerns are prompting manufacturers to develop biodegradable and recyclable plastics. These sustainable compounds help reduce medical waste and carbon footprint, aligning with global eco-friendly initiatives. Their adoption is reshaping product design and supply chain practices within the industry.
• Technological advancements in compounding processes: Innovations such as automation, nanotechnology, and advanced mixing techniques are improving the quality and performance of medical plastics. These advancements enable the production of highly specialized compounds with enhanced properties, supporting complex medical applications and increasing efficiency.
• Growing focus on sterilization-compatible plastics: The demand for plastics that withstand sterilization processes like gamma radiation and ethylene oxide is rising. These materials ensure the safety and longevity of medical devices, reducing contamination risks. This trend is critical for maintaining high standards of hygiene and compliance in healthcare settings.
• Expansion of customized and application-specific compounds: Customized plastics tailored for specific medical applications are gaining popularity. These compounds offer optimized properties such as flexibility, transparency, or chemical resistance, enabling manufacturers to meet diverse clinical needs. This trend promotes innovation and differentiation in the medical plastics market.
These emerging trends are significantly reshaping the medical plastic compound market in Thailand by fostering innovation, sustainability, and safety. The shift towards biocompatible and eco-friendly materials, coupled with technological advancements, is enhancing product performance and environmental responsibility. Customization and sterilization compatibility are enabling manufacturers to meet evolving healthcare demands more effectively. Collectively, these developments are positioning Thailand as a competitive leader in the regional medical plastics industry, driving growth and sustainability in the sector.

Medical Plastic Compound Market in Thailand Driver and Challenges
The medical plastic compound market in Thailand is influenced by a variety of technological, economic, and regulatory factors. Rapid advancements in medical technology demand innovative materials, while economic growth in Thailand boosts healthcare infrastructure investments. Regulatory standards ensure safety and quality, shaping market dynamics. Additionally, global supply chain disruptions and environmental concerns impact material sourcing and sustainability practices. These drivers and challenges collectively shape the growth trajectory and competitive landscape of the market, requiring stakeholders to adapt to evolving technological innovations, regulatory frameworks, and economic conditions to maintain competitiveness and meet healthcare demands effectively.
The factors responsible for driving the medical plastic compound market in Thailand include:-
• Technological Innovation: The continuous development of advanced medical devices necessitates high-performance plastic compounds, fostering market growth. Innovations in biocompatible and sterilizable plastics enable manufacturers to meet stringent healthcare standards, expanding application scope. This technological evolution enhances product efficacy, safety, and durability, attracting healthcare providers and device manufacturers. As Thailand healthcare sector modernizes, demand for specialized plastic compounds increases, driving market expansion. Companies investing in R&D are positioned to capitalize on emerging opportunities, making innovation a key driver for sustained growth in this competitive landscape.
• Growing Healthcare Infrastructure: Thailand expanding healthcare infrastructure, driven by government initiatives and private sector investments, increases demand for medical devices and equipment. This growth necessitates high-quality plastic compounds for manufacturing medical devices, disposables, and hospital equipment. The rising prevalence of chronic diseases and an aging population further amplify demand for medical products, fueling market expansion. Improved healthcare access and increased hospital construction projects contribute to a steady rise in demand for medical plastics, making infrastructure development a significant growth driver.
• Regulatory Standards and Quality Assurance: Stringent regulatory frameworks in Thailand ensure the safety, biocompatibility, and sterilization of medical plastics. Compliance with international standards such as ISO and ASTM influences material selection and manufacturing processes. These regulations encourage innovation in developing safer, more effective plastic compounds, fostering market growth. Companies that adhere to regulatory requirements gain competitive advantages, while non-compliance can lead to market restrictions. Regulatory standards thus serve as both a driver for quality improvement and a barrier for entry, shaping the competitive landscape.
• Environmental Sustainability and Recycling Initiatives: Increasing awareness of environmental impact prompts adoption of eco-friendly plastics and recycling practices in Thailand medical sector. The demand for biodegradable and recyclable plastic compounds is rising, driven by government policies and global sustainability trends. This shift encourages innovation in sustainable materials, influencing supply chains and manufacturing processes. Companies investing in green technologies can differentiate themselves and meet regulatory and consumer expectations, although transitioning to sustainable practices presents technical and economic challenges that impact market dynamics.
• Global Supply Chain Dynamics: Disruptions caused by geopolitical tensions, pandemics, and trade policies affect the availability and cost of raw materials for medical plastics. Dependence on imported raw materials exposes the market to supply chain vulnerabilities, impacting production schedules and pricing. Diversification of supply sources and local manufacturing initiatives are strategies to mitigate risks. These dynamics influence market stability, cost competitiveness, and innovation capacity, making supply chain resilience a critical factor for sustained growth.
The challenges in the medical plastic compound market in Thailand are:
• Regulatory Complexity and Compliance Costs: Navigating Thailand evolving regulatory landscape requires significant investment in quality assurance, testing, and certification processes. Compliance costs can be high, especially for small and medium-sized enterprises, potentially limiting market entry and innovation. Stringent standards, while ensuring safety, also pose barriers to rapid product development and commercialization. Companies must continuously adapt to changing regulations, which can delay product launches and increase operational expenses, impacting overall market growth.
• Environmental Concerns and Sustainability Pressures: The environmental impact of plastic waste, especially in medical applications, presents a major challenge. Developing biodegradable or recyclable plastics that meet medical standards involves technical complexities and higher costs. Balancing environmental sustainability with performance requirements is difficult, and failure to address these concerns can lead to regulatory penalties and reputational damage. The push for greener alternatives requires significant R&D investment, which may slow down innovation and increase product prices.
• Supply Chain Disruptions and Raw Material Volatility: Dependence on imported raw materials makes the market vulnerable to global supply chain disruptions, such as geopolitical conflicts, pandemics, and transportation issues. Price volatility of raw materials like resins and additives increases production costs and affects profit margins. Limited local sourcing options exacerbate these issues, forcing companies to seek alternative suppliers or develop local manufacturing capabilities. These challenges hinder consistent supply, increase costs, and can delay product availability, impacting market stability and growth prospects.
In summary, the medical plastic compound market in Thailand is shaped by technological advancements, infrastructure development, regulatory standards, sustainability initiatives, and supply chain dynamics. While these drivers foster growth and innovation, challenges such as regulatory compliance, environmental concerns, and supply chain vulnerabilities pose significant hurdles. The overall impact is a market that is evolving rapidly, requiring stakeholders to innovate, adapt, and invest strategically to capitalize on emerging opportunities while managing risks effectively. This dynamic environment offers substantial growth potential but demands resilience and agility from industry players.
